Homesnap

Homesnap is quite an interesting app buyers should use when hunting for a house. All you have to do is take a photograph of the property you like more. The app will instantly get you information on that house, including when was the last time it sold, its current value, bedroom and bathroom number, taxes involved, similar listing nearby, local schools nearby, and more. If the house you’ve photographed is on sale, you might even be able to see photos from inside; and if that’s your dream home, use the app to get in touch with the realtor and schedule a meeting.

AroundMe

AroundMe identifies your current location and gives you a complete list of attractions and business nearby, distances included. The app can be extremely helpful when searching for a house in that specific neighborhood. Look for coffee shops, banks, ATMs, hospitals, gas stations, schools, supermarkets and more, and choose whether or not if that would be a good place to purchase a house and make a living.

WalkScore

For some home buyers, walkability is a key factor when searching for a place to live. WalkScore is an extremely useful app. It allows users to see exactly how close or how far away their future home will be to certain amenities, including stores, schools, attractions, pharmacies, and more. The app will help you make a sensible choice whether you have a car or not. It’s also useful when searching for coffee shops and restaurants because it tells you how sociable a certain neighborhood can be.

RealtyTrac

RealtyTrac is quite an unusual app. It is incredibly resourceful because it permits users to search for complete property information. Users will have thousands of properties to choose from. RealtyTrac even reveals houses that are not for sale. In addition, it lets people see how much an owner has to pay on his mortgage as well as the property’s current value. Potential buyers will then be able to uncover new opportunities. They can contact the owners and ask them if they’re interested in a deal. Basically, RealtyTrac is an opportunity for buyers to see inventory that others don’t know is available. Currently, the app has over 125 million homes registered.

Zillow

Even though Zillow is not the newest app out there, it is one of the most important for both buyers and sellers. It has the most significant inventory of properties in the US and it is superior in its capabilities to sort listings by different criteria. Zillow allows access for state specific mortgage rates as well as transaction history for property listings; all of these make it the best online platform to start searching for a new home. Sync the app with your Zillow.com account and save your searches. Browse through millions of listing and find the house of your dreams with a few swaps on a screen.
